python按名字按拼音排序话题讨论。解读python按名字按拼音排序知识,想了解学习python按名字按拼音排序,请参与python按名字按拼音排序话题讨论。
python按名字按拼音排序话题已于 2025-08-17 05:39:31 更新
Python 中的拼音库 PyPinyin 提供了汉字转拼音的功能,适用于注音、排序和检索等场景。PyPinyin 是基于 hotto/pinyin 库开发的。要使用 PyPinyin,首先需要安装,通过 pip 安装即可。安装完成后导入库,不报错说明安装成功。PyPinyin 的主要功能包括基本拼音转换、多音字处理、风格转换、错误处理和严格模式。基...
要将全部中文姓名一秒转为拼音,你可以使用Python中的以下三种库:xpinyin库:安装与导入:通过pip安装xpinyin库,并在代码中导入。功能:轻松实现中文名转拼音,支持显示声调、去除空格以及获取拼音首字母。使用方法:直接调用Pinyin方法进行转换。pypinyin库:安装与导入:通过pip安装pypinyin库,并在代码中导入。
首先,推荐使用`xpinyin`库,通过pip安装并导入,轻松实现中文名转拼音。直接调用`Pinyin`方法即可进行转换。若需要显示声调或去除空格,`xpinyin`都能满足需求。对于中文名转拼音首字母,`xpinyin`同样简便。其次,`pypinyin`是另一种有效选择。通过pip安装并导入后,可直接实现中文名转拼音。对于声调展示或...
在遇到无法转拼音的字符时,`errors`参数允许自定义处理,如忽略、替换或使用自定义函数。严格模式`strict`则根据《汉语拼音方案》规则处理声母和韵母。此外,还可以自定义拼音库,如将 "朝阳" 的发音改为 "chao yang"。总的来说,PyPinyin为Python项目中处理中文文件名提供了便利的工具,通过合理配置参数...
这需要用到python中拼音库的用法。Python中提供了汉字转拼音的库,名字叫做PyPinyin,可以用于汉字注音,排序,检索等等场合,是基于hotto或pinyin这个库开发的。它有这么几个特性。1.根据词组智能匹配最正确的拼音2.支持多音字,3.简单的繁体支持,注音支持,4.支持多种不同拼音或注音风格。
先安装:pip install pypinyin 安装:pip install pypinyin
PyPinyin 能够按照自定义的规则进行拼音输出。应用场景:主要用于解决中文文件名乱码问题,提高项目的可部署性和可维护性。也可以用于其他需要汉字转拼音的场景,如文本处理、数据分析等。通过使用 PyPinyin 库,开发者可以灵活地对中文进行拼音转换,并根据项目需求进行自定义设置。
或 load_phrases_dict 方法进行自定义,以达到特定的拼音输出。这样,即使在项目中遇到中文资源文件,也能通过 PyPinyin 实现有效管理和转换。总的来说,Python 的 PyPinyin 库为处理中文文件名提供了强大的工具,通过灵活的配置和自定义词库,可以解决文件名乱码问题,提高项目的可部署性和可维护性。
##将xm指定为姓名的中文拼音表示(空格分隔姓与名) xm='ma liu' print(' '.join(xm.split()[::-1]))
1. **使用拼音排序**:- 在大多数的电子表格软件(如Microsoft Excel、Google Sheets等)中,你可以使用拼音对姓名进行排序。通常情况下,姓名会按照拼音的首字母顺序排序。对于复姓“曾”,其拼音为“Zeng”,所以它会和其它以“Z”开头的姓名一起排序,而不会出现前置问题。2. **自定义排序规则**...